Since the moment arm lengths for hip extension appear to be similar between the semitendinosus, semimembranosus and biceps femoris (long head)(Dostal et al. 1986), this may imply that one muscle in each subgroup is better suited for producing large excursions with high joint
angular velocities while the other may be better suited for performing very forceful muscular contractions over short excursions (see review by Lieber and Fridén, 2000).

They report that when performing plantarflexion with the knee fully extended, the medial and lateral gastrocnemius displayed superior peak muscle activity with increasing
angular velocity,
while the soleus displayed decreasing peak muscle activity with increasing
velocity.
Knee flexion and extension
angular velocities can reach 1,083 and 1,165 degrees / s,
while hip flexion and extension
angular velocities can reach 726 and 666 degrees / s (Kivi et al. 2002).
